About Time Bandits

The movie "Time Bandits" is a British fantasy adventure film that was released in 1981. Directed by Terry Gilliam, it revolves around the story of a young boy, Kevin, who finds his wardrobe acting as a gateway through which a group of time-travelling dwarves emerge. These dwarves stole a map from the Supreme Being and are using it to travel through different points in time, intending to steal riches. However, they're pursued by the Supreme Being and Evil. As Kevin joins their adventures, they encounter various historical and fantastical characters.

Making / Production

"Time Bandits" was brought to life by director Terry Gilliam. Alongside Gilliam, the movie was co-written by fellow Monty Python member Michael Palin. With its unique concept and impressive cast, the movie is an amalgamation of British comedy and fantastic adventure.

Trivia / Interesting Facts

  • Terry Gilliam's children helped inspire the film's dwarves.
  • This film is the first in Gilliam's "Trilogy of Imagination", followed by "Brazil" and "The Adventures of Baron Munchausen".
  • Sean Connery's initial appearance in the film was based on a joke between the scriptwriters.

Awards

"Time Bandits" was nominated for "Best Fantasy Film" and "Best Costumes" by the Academy of Science Fiction, Fantasy & Horror Films in 1982.

Music, Soundtrack

  • The film's theme song "Dream Away" was written and performed by George Harrison.
  • The film also uses classical music pieces, with its versatile soundtrack supplementing the whimsical and adventurous nature of the film.
